automotive grade inductor for powertrain system

The automotive grade inductor for powertrain system represents a critical electronic component specifically engineered to meet the demanding requirements of modern vehicle propulsion technologies. These sophisticated inductors serve as essential elements in power management circuits, electromagnetic interference filtering, and energy storage applications within electric, hybrid, and conventional automotive powertrains. The primary function of an automotive grade inductor for powertrain system involves storing electrical energy in magnetic fields, smoothing current fluctuations, and maintaining stable power delivery across various operating conditions. These components excel in DC-DC converter applications, where they regulate voltage levels between different powertrain subsystems, ensuring optimal performance and efficiency. The technological features of automotive grade inductors for powertrain systems include enhanced temperature resistance, superior magnetic core materials, and robust construction designed to withstand harsh automotive environments. Advanced ferrite or powder core technologies enable these inductors to operate effectively across wide temperature ranges, typically from -40°C to +150°C, while maintaining consistent electrical characteristics. The automotive grade inductor for powertrain system incorporates specialized wire winding techniques and insulation materials that resist vibration, moisture, and chemical exposure common in vehicle applications. These inductors demonstrate exceptional current handling capabilities, low DC resistance, and minimal electromagnetic interference generation. Applications span across electric vehicle battery management systems, hybrid powertrain controllers, engine control modules, and regenerative braking circuits. The automotive grade inductor for powertrain system plays crucial roles in inverter circuits, where precise current control ensures smooth motor operation and maximum energy efficiency. These components support advanced powertrain technologies including variable frequency drives, power factor correction circuits, and high-voltage isolation systems that define modern automotive electrical architectures.

Advanced Thermal Management and Environmental Resilience

Advanced Thermal Management and Environmental Resilience

The automotive grade inductor for powertrain system incorporates cutting-edge thermal management technologies that enable consistent performance across extreme temperature variations encountered in automotive applications. These inductors feature specialized core materials and advanced heat dissipation designs that maintain electrical characteristics from arctic cold starts to desert highway conditions. The thermal management system utilizes high-performance ferrite cores combined with optimized winding configurations that efficiently distribute heat generation, preventing hotspot formation that could compromise component reliability. Environmental resilience extends beyond temperature management to include resistance against moisture, salt spray, vibration, and chemical exposure common in automotive environments. The automotive grade inductor for powertrain system employs protective coatings and encapsulation techniques that seal internal components against environmental contamination while maintaining optimal electromagnetic performance. This environmental protection ensures consistent operation throughout the vehicle's operational lifespan, regardless of climate conditions or driving environments. The thermal stability directly impacts powertrain efficiency by maintaining consistent inductance values and minimal resistance variations across operating temperatures. This stability enables predictable power management behavior, allowing control systems to optimize energy distribution and consumption patterns effectively. The automotive grade inductor for powertrain system demonstrates exceptional performance retention even after thousands of thermal cycling events, ensuring long-term reliability in demanding automotive applications. Advanced materials science innovations contribute to the superior thermal characteristics, incorporating specialized magnetic materials that exhibit minimal temperature-dependent property variations. These materials maintain magnetic permeability and saturation characteristics across wide temperature ranges, ensuring consistent electrical performance regardless of environmental conditions. The robust environmental protection extends component lifespan significantly, reducing maintenance requirements and warranty claims while improving overall vehicle reliability and customer satisfaction.
Precision Power Management and Electromagnetic Compatibility

Precision Power Management and Electromagnetic Compatibility

The automotive grade inductor for powertrain system delivers exceptional precision in power management applications, enabling sophisticated control of electrical energy flow throughout complex powertrain architectures. These inductors provide precise current regulation in DC-DC converter circuits, ensuring stable voltage delivery to critical powertrain components including motor controllers, battery management systems, and regenerative braking circuits. The precision characteristics enable advanced power management strategies that optimize energy efficiency and extend electric vehicle driving ranges while maintaining consistent performance across varying load conditions. Electromagnetic compatibility represents a fundamental design consideration, with the automotive grade inductor for powertrain system incorporating advanced shielding techniques that minimize electromagnetic interference generation and susceptibility. This electromagnetic compatibility ensures seamless integration with sensitive automotive electronic systems including advanced driver assistance systems, infotainment platforms, and wireless communication modules. The carefully engineered magnetic field containment prevents interference with nearby electronic components while maintaining optimal electrical performance characteristics. Precision manufacturing processes ensure consistent electrical parameters across production batches, enabling predictable system behavior and simplified design verification processes for automotive engineers. The automotive grade inductor for powertrain system maintains tight tolerance specifications for inductance values, DC resistance, and current handling capabilities, facilitating precise circuit modeling and performance prediction during system development phases. Advanced winding techniques and core material selection contribute to excellent linearity characteristics, ensuring predictable behavior across wide current and frequency ranges typical in automotive powertrain applications. The electromagnetic compatibility extends to conducted and radiated emissions compliance with stringent automotive standards, simplifying system-level electromagnetic compatibility validation processes. These inductors incorporate specialized construction techniques that minimize parasitic capacitance and resistance while maximizing electromagnetic field containment, resulting in clean electrical performance that supports advanced powertrain control algorithms and high-frequency switching applications essential for modern vehicle electrification technologies.
